Transaction 734be7580ac14d155bd96881f47c245a6f96e7508766eb796246f22299a42359

1 Input
2 Outputs
  • 734be7580ac14d155bd96881f47c245a6f96e7508766eb796246f22299a42359:0
  • value  2116600
    address  1H1vYrTRjcU73qkKPMBv7Rd3dsdWJBDxXs
  • 734be7580ac14d155bd96881f47c245a6f96e7508766eb796246f22299a42359:1
  • value  352797173
    address  34Uxmv12DCvV6i8AeiLPrbs1sq6EDmdx2L